MSO Announces January 22 Concert

The Mobile Symphony Orchestra (MSO) is performing Fireworks of Jupiter on January 22 at 7:30 p.m. and January 23 at 2:30 p.m. at Mobile’s Saenger Theatre. The concert centers on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art’s Jupiter Symphony. Danish cellist Jonathan Swensen, a 25-year-old who MSO calls a “rising classical star,” joins the orchestra for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ky’s “Rococo Variations.” Four-concert season memberships are available at $68-$272, and individual tickets are on sale for $20-$89. Student tickets are $10. They may be purchased online, by phone at 251-432-2010 or at the MSO box office at 257 Dauphin Street. Masks are required for this performance, and MSO will review its COVID-19 safety policies on a concert-by-concert basis.
